Types of Business Safes

Business safes come in various types, each designed to meet specific security needs. Fireproof safes are essential for protecting documents and valuables from fire damage. These safes can withstand high temperatures, ensuring your important papers remain intact. Burglary-resistant safes offer robust protection against theft. They feature reinforced steel and complex locking mechanisms, making unauthorized access extremely difficult. Data safes are specialized to protect electronic media from both fire and theft. They maintain a controlled environment to prevent data loss due to heat or humidity.

For instance, a fireproof safe is ideal for storing legal documents in an office setting. A burglary-resistant safe is perfect for retail businesses needing to secure cash and high-value items. Data safes are crucial for companies that store sensitive digital information, such as customer records or proprietary data.

Key Factors to Consider When Choosing a Locksmith

When selecting a locksmith for your business safe, ensure they possess the necessary qualifications and certifications. A professional locksmith should have credentials from recognized institutions, such as the Associated Locksmiths of America (ALOA). Additionally, they should be licensed and insured to guarantee their legitimacy and your protection.

Experience and specialization in commercial safes are crucial. A locksmith with extensive experience will handle various safe models and brands, ensuring efficient and secure service. Specialization in commercial safes means they understand the unique security needs of businesses, providing tailored solutions.

To verify a locksmith’s credibility and reputation, check online reviews and ask for references. Positive feedback from previous clients indicates reliability and quality service. Assessing Your Business Needs

To evaluate your business’s specific security needs, start by considering the value of the assets you need to protect. High-value items require more robust security measures. Next, think about the frequency of access to the safe. If multiple employees need regular access, you might need a safe with advanced access control features. Additionally, the location of the safe within your business premises is crucial. A safe in a high-traffic area may need extra security features compared to one in a secluded spot.

Consulting with a security expert can provide valuable insights. They can assess your unique situation and recommend the best safe for your business. For instance, they might suggest a safe with biometric locks if you need high security and frequent access. Don’t hesitate to reach out to professionals for tailored advice. Understanding Locksmith Warranties and Guarantees

Locksmiths often provide various types of warranties and guarantees to ensure customer satisfaction and trust. These can include product warranties for the safe itself and service guarantees for the locksmith’s work. A product warranty typically covers defects in materials and workmanship, ensuring that the safe functions as intended. Service guarantees, on the other hand, assure the quality of the locksmith’s installation and maintenance work.

Having a warranty is crucial for both the safe and the locksmith’s work. It provides peace of mind, knowing that any issues arising from defects or poor workmanship will be addressed promptly. For example, a comprehensive warranty should cover the replacement of faulty parts, labor costs for repairs, and even emergency services if the safe fails to operate correctly.

Maintenance and Upkeep of Your Business Safe

Regular maintenance is crucial to keep your business safe in optimal condition. Start by scheduling routine inspections to check for any signs of wear or damage. Clean the safe’s exterior and interior to prevent dust buildup, which can affect its locking mechanism. Lubricate the hinges and bolts to ensure smooth operation.

Common issues include difficulty in opening the safe, which might be due to worn-out components or a malfunctioning lock. If you encounter such problems, it’s essential to address them promptly. For instance, if the lock is not working correctly, consider contacting a professional locksmith.
